CHAP. 360.— An Act granting a pension to Abial G. Chamberlain.June 4, 1888. *Be it enacted by the Senate and House of Representatives of the United States of America in Congress assembled*,Abial G. Chamberlain.Pension increased. That the Secretary of the Interior be. and he hereby is, authorized and directed to place on the pension-roll, subject to the provisions of the pension laws, the name Abial G. Chamberlain, late Company K. First Massachusetts Volunteers, and pay him a pension at the rate of forty-five dollars per month, in lieu of the pension now received by him. Approved, June 4, 1888.
